Eligibility criteria for the fillable online property tax exemption for homestead
To qualify for the fillable online property tax exemption for homestead, applicants generally need to meet specific criteria, which may vary by state. Common eligibility requirements include:
- The property must be the applicant's primary residence.
- The homeowner must be a legal resident of the state where the property is located.
- Applicants may need to provide proof of ownership and residency.
- Age, income, or disability status may also influence eligibility in some jurisdictions.

Required documents for the fillable online property tax exemption for homestead
When completing the fillable online property tax exemption for homestead, applicants must prepare various documents to support their application. Commonly required documents include:
- Proof of identity, such as a driver's license or state ID.
- Documentation confirming ownership of the property, like a deed or mortgage statement.
- Evidence of residency, such as utility bills or lease agreements.
